Assay Description Organism Bioactivity Reference
Cytotoxicity against Spodoptera litura cells assessed as growth inhibition at 20 mg/L after 24 hr by MTT assay relative to control Spodoptera litura 23.1 %
Antifungal activity against Ceratocystis paradoxa assessed as mycelial growth inhibition at 100 ug/disc after 2 to 4 days by disk diffusion method relative to control Ceratocystis paradoxa 0.0 % Antifungal activity against Ceratocystis paradoxa assessed as mycelial growth inhibition at 100 ug/disc after 2 to 4 days by disk diffusion method relative to control Ceratocystis paradoxa 0.0 mm
Antifungal activity against Alternaria mali assessed as mycelial growth inhibition at 100 ug/disk after 2 to 4 days by disk diffusion method relative to control Alternaria mali 24.2 % Antifungal activity against Alternaria mali assessed as mycelial growth inhibition at 100 ug/disk after 2 to 4 days by disk diffusion method relative to control Alternaria mali 2.4 mm
Antifungal activity against Athelia rolfsii assessed as mycelial growth inhibition at 100 ug/disk after 2 to 4 days by disk diffusion method relative to control Athelia rolfsii 31.9 % Antifungal activity against Athelia rolfsii assessed as mycelial growth inhibition at 100 ug/disk after 2 to 4 days by disk diffusion method relative to control Athelia rolfsii 3.7 mm
Antifungal activity against Magnaporthe grisea assessed as mycelial growth inhibition at 100 ug/disk after 2 to 4 days by disk diffusion method relative to control Magnaporthe grisea 0.0 % Antifungal activity against Magnaporthe grisea assessed as mycelial growth inhibition at 100 ug/disk after 2 to 4 days by disk diffusion method relative to control Magnaporthe grisea 0.0 mm
